UFC 135
  • Saturday 09.24.2011 at 09:00 PM ET
  • U.S. Broadcast: Pay Per View | Prelims: Spike TV
  • Promotion: Ultimate Fighting Championship
  • Ownership: Zuffa, LLC
  • Venue: Pepsi Center
  • Location: Denver, Colorado, United States
  • Enclosure: Octagon
  • TV Announcers: Mike Goldberg, Joe Rogan
  • Ring Announcer: Bruce Buffer
  • Post-Fight Interviews: Joe Rogan
  • Ticket Revenue (live gate): $2,089,575
  • Attendance: 16,344 (Paid: 14,247)
  • PPV Buys / Buyrate: 520,000 | TV Ratings: 1.6M viewers (Spike Prelims)
  • MMA Bouts: 10
  • Promotion Links:
  • Event Links:
Bout   Info
Jon Jones   defeats   Quinton Jackson   via Submission, Rear Naked Choke   1:14 Round 4 of 5, 16:14 Total Bout Page
Josh Koscheck   defeats   Matt Hughes   via KO/TKO, Punches   4:59 Round 1 of 3 Bout Page
Mark Hunt   defeats   Ben Rothwell   via Decision, Unanimous   3 Rounds, 15:00 Total Bout Page
Travis Browne   defeats   Rob Broughton   via Decision, Unanimous   3 Rounds, 15:00 Total Bout Page
Nate Diaz   defeats   Takanori Gomi   via Submission, Armbar   4:27 Round 1 of 3 Bout Page
Tony Ferguson   defeats   Aaron Riley   via KO/TKO, Jaw Injury   5:00 Round 1 of 3 Bout Page
Tim Boetsch   defeats   Nick Ring   via Decision, Unanimous   3 Rounds, 15:00 Total Bout Page
Júnior Assunção   defeats   Eddie Yagin   via Decision, Unanimous   3 Rounds, 15:00 Total Bout Page
Takeya Mizugaki   defeats   Cole Escovedo   via KO/TKO, Punches   4:30 Round 2 of 3, 9:30 Total Bout Page
James Te Huna   defeats   Ricardo Romero   via KO/TKO, Punches   0:47 Round 1 of 3 Bout Page
